I live in the UK and would like to be able to search for UK results. e.g. Amazon UK results when I search for a product etc. with the option of a world wide search if I don't get the results I want

To add search plugins for sites like Amazon.co.uk or Google.co.uk to Firefox, open this page in Firefox and then search for or click on the sites you are interested in: http://mycroft.mozdev.org/

When you tap on one of the listed search plugins, Firefox will ask whether you want to install it.

After that, you can open the Firefox add-on manager and tap to disable any of the built-in search engines that you don't want to use.
